karate
English
Etymology
Borrowed from Japanese 空手 (karate), from 唐手 (karate), from Okinawan 唐手 (tūdī, “Chinese hand”).
Pronunciation
- enPR: kə-räʹti, IPA(key): /kəˈɹɑː.ti/, /kəˈɹɑː.teɪ/
Audio (Southern England) (file) - Rhymes: -ɑːti
Noun
karate (uncountable)
- An Okinawan martial art involving primarily punching and kicking, but additionally, advanced throws, arm bars, grappling and all means of fighting.

Verb
karate (third-person singular simple present karates, present participle karateing, simple past and past participle karated)
- (transitive, informal) To attack (somebody or something) with karate or similar techniques.

Indonesian
Etymology
From Japanese 空手 (karate, literally “the state of being empty-handed”), from earlier 唐手 (karate, literally “Tang Dynasty; China+ hand”), from Okinawan 唐手 (トゥーディー, tūdī, “empty hand”).
Pronunciation
- IPA(key): /ka.ra.te/
- Hyphenation: ka‧ra‧té
Noun
karaté
- (sports, martial arts) karate; an Okinawan martial art involving primarily punching and kicking, but additionally, advanced throws, arm bars, grappling and all means of fighting
